How Do You Implement Schema for AI Citations?
Definition: JSON-LD - A JavaScript-based format for linked data that is the preferred implementation method for modern SEO.
Implementing schema requires utilizing JSON-LD to define the technical specifications of your SaaS offering and its unique value proposition.
- Use TechArticle schema for technical documentation and blogs.
- Apply SoftwareApplication schema to specify pricing and compatibility.
- Include FAQPage schema to answer high-intent user queries directly.
Which Schema Types Are Essential for SaaS Founders in 2026?
| Schema Type | Primary Use Case | AEO Benefit |
|---|---|---|
| SoftwareApplication | Main product landing pages | Displays price, OS, and ratings in AI summaries. |
| HowTo | Tutorials and guidebooks | Powers step-by-step responses in voice search. |
| FAQPage | Common objections and questions | High probability of direct quotation by AI models. |
| TechArticle | Thought leadership and blogs | Establishes E-E-A-T for complex topics. |

Should I use microdata or JSON-LD for AEO?
Google and most AI developers recommend JSON-LD (JavaScript Object Notation for Linked Data) because it is easier to maintain and less prone to errors during site redesigns. It is currently the industry standard for AEO in 2026.
